Henninger College & Career Center



Vision

The vision of the College and Career Center at Henninger High School is to empower students with skills and resources so they can discover a path to a fulfilling career and make their own unique marks on the world. 

Mission

Recognizing that career development is a life-long process, the mission of the College and Career at Henninger High School is to get students thinking about their future after high school. Whether the student is heading to college, trade school, military, or joining the workforce, the time to begin career awareness, exploration, and preparedness is now.

Zonta Club of Syracuse (3 applications)
  • Application Deadline: April 15, 2023
  • Edna B, Davis Music Scholarship (up to $2,000)
    • Qualifications:  Young women pursuing music education, professional performance or other related degree.  Must include a recommendation from music teacher or choral director.
  • Ursula Pettengill Scholarship (up to $1,500)
    • Qualifications: Young women who are pursuing either dietectics, nutrition, health science or related field. 
  • Amelia Earhart Scholarship (up to $1,000)
    • Qualifications:  high school senior girl with a grade point average of 3.2 or higher.  The applicant will have been accepted into a two or four year academic program in one of the proposed majors - sciences, engineering, aeronautics or mathematics.  Consideration will be given for financial need.
  • Applications are available in the college and career center.

Dowdell Scholarship Award 
 
  • Application Deadline:  April 30th
  • Qualifications: 

1. Applicant must be a male student of color in their senior year attending high school in Onondaga County.

2. Applicant must be accepted as a full-time student to an accredited university or college and provide a copy of acceptance letter.

3. Applicant must have attained a minimum academic average of 80 / “B”

4. Applicant must submit three (3) letters of recommendation providing character reference, academic excellence, and political or community participation.

5. Applicant must provide an essay consisting of a minimum of 500 words and addressing one of the following subjects:

· Why I should receive the Dennis Dowdell Scholarship Award.

· How I expect higher education to change my life.

· What I expect to contribute to society after I attain a college education.

· Future goals and aspirations.

6. Applicant must attend an interview with the Omega Psi Phi Fraternity Incorporated, Chi Pi Chapter (Dressed appropriately).

  •  See the College and Career Center for more information
